What is the best time to visit the Maldives?

The best time to visit the Maldives is between January and April, during the dry northeast monsoon season. This period offers plenty of sunshine and lower humidity, making it well-suited to outdoor activities and beach relaxation.

How do I get to the Maldives from Koblenz?

Traveling to the Maldives from Koblenz typically involves a flight to a major hub like Dubai, Doha, or Singapore, followed by a connecting flight to Velana International Airport (MLE) in Malé. The total travel time can vary but usually exceeds 10 hours.

What types of accommodations are available in the Maldives?

The Maldives offers a range of accommodations, from beach villas with direct access to the sand and sea to overwater bungalows with private pools. Many resorts also offer all-inclusive packages for a hassle-free vacation.

What activities can I enjoy in the Maldives?

The Maldives offers a wide range of activities, including snorkeling and diving in healthy coral reefs, relaxing spa treatments, gourmet dining, private island picnics, sunset cruises, and cultural excursions to local islands.

Is the Maldives suitable for families?

Yes, the Maldives is suitable for families. Many resorts offer family-friendly accommodations and activities, making it a good destination for a fun and relaxing family vacation.

What is the weather like in the Maldives?

The Maldives enjoys a tropical climate year-round, with two main seasons: the dry northeast monsoon from January to April and the wet southwest monsoon from May to October. Even during the wet season, there are usually long periods of sunshine.

Are there any cultural experiences in the Maldives?

Yes, many resorts offer cultural excursions to local islands, providing a unique opportunity to experience the local culture and traditions of the Maldives.

What is the currency used in the Maldives?

The currency used in the Maldives is the Maldivian Rufiyaa (MVR). However, US dollars are widely accepted, and many resorts operate on a cashless system where everything is charged to your room.

Do I need a visa to visit the Maldives?

Most nationalities, including German citizens, receive a 30-day visa on arrival in the Maldives. Ensure your passport is valid for at least six months from your arrival date.

What should I pack for a trip to the Maldives?

Pack light, breathable clothing, swimwear, s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ses. If you plan to visit local islands, pack modest clothing that covers your shoulders and knees. Don't forget your camera to capture the stunning scenery.
